Problems with file corruption on C240
Hi,
I'm trying to run Sarge on my C240, but I've hit a roadblock. The
installation routine completes fine using the minimal CD and it will
reboot into the new Debian install, but after a day or two it eats my
files. The problem can be quickly reproduced by doing something like
repeatedly compiling the kernel or using 'stress'.
Here some (hopefully relevant) lines from dmesg:
EXT3-fs error (device sda5): ext3_free_blocks: bit already cleared
for block 249189
EXT3-fs error (device sda5): ext3_free_blocks: bit already cleared
for block 249190
EXT3-fs error (device sda5): ext3_free_blocks: bit already cleared
for block 249191
... repeats many times
EXT3-fs error (device sda5) in start_transaction: Readonly filesystem
... repeats many times
If I reboot, it remounts the filesystem as read/write. Sometimes
everything is fine, sometimes a load of stuff shows up in /lost
+found, and sometimes it just refuses to boot and I have to reinstall.
Is this caused by my stupidity or is it the hardware? I'm confident
that I've got the FWSCSI chain terminated properly, there are no
other devices on the chain and the HD has an ID of 5.
